What Sets Non Gamstop Casinos Apart?

Non Gamstop casinos operate outside the UK’s main self-exclusion scheme, offering players access to gambling platforms not registered with Gamstop. This means users who have chosen self-exclusion through Gamstop might still find these casinos accessible. But what truly distinguishes these sites? Typically, they are licensed by offshore regulators rather than the UK Gambling Commission, allowing more flexible terms and a wider array of games from providers like Pragmatic Play and Play’n GO. However, this freedom comes with certain risks, so understanding the landscape is crucial for anyone intrigued by this alternative.

Regulation and Player Protection: What’s Missing?

The UK Gambling Commission enforces strict rules around fairness, transparency, and responsible gambling, but these don’t extend to non Gamstop casinos. This regulatory gap can expose players to issues like delayed withdrawals, inadequate dispute resolution, or absence of self-exclusion tools.

While many offshore casinos do implement responsible gambling measures voluntarily, they may not have the same rigor or enforcement. This is where player vigilance becomes paramount.
